Differential-scanning-calorimetric study of the irreversible thermal denaturation of 8 kDa cytotoxin from the sea anemone Radianthus macrodactylus.

G G Zhadan1, V L Shnyrov.   

Abstract

A differential-scanning-calorimetric study of the thermal denaturation of a sea-anemone (Radianthus macrodactylus) 8 kDa cytolytic toxin was carried out. The calorimetric traces were found to be irreversible and scan-rate-dependent under the experimental conditions employed. Scan-rate-dependent thermograms were explained in terms of a two-state kinetic model N k -->D, where k is a first-order kinetic constant that changes with temperature as given by the Arrhenius equation, N is the native state of the toxin, and D the denatured one.
